Impacts of Real-Time Passenger Information Signs in Rail Stations at the Massachusetts Bay Transportation Authority

Abstract: Real-time information systems have been used in transit agencies around the world to better inform passengers of their estimated wait. In 2012, the Massachusetts Bay Transportation Authority (MBTA) rolled out new real-time countdown information across its heavy rail system. These signs display the estimated arrival for the next two trains in each direction. This paper examines whether the introduction of real-time arrival signage leads to reduced expectations of wait time, improved satisfaction with the MBTA, … Show more

“…Previous studies provide evidence that the dissemination of RTI improves user satisfaction with the public transport service, reduces their perceived and actual waiting times and increases ridership. Several empirical studies found that passengers' perceived waiting times decreased substantially after RTI systems were deployed, although waiting times were still overestimated by passengers (Mishalani et al 2006, Dziekan and Kottenhoff 2007, Chow et al 2014. Moreover, waiting times were shorter among users that accessed RTI from their mobile phone due to either departure time choice (Watkins et al 2011, Brakewood et al 2014 or route choice effects (Cats et al 2011).…”

“…In contrast, passengers that coordinate their arrival based on RTI will be more sensitive towards arrivals that are earlier than the predicted arrival times since this may result with missed connections. Chow et al (2014) suggested that inaccurate RTI could result with greater anxiety and dissatisfaction than the absence of information. They argue that information provision raises passenger expectations and hence increases the importance of service reliability.…”

“…For example, Chow, Block-Schachter, and Hickey conducted in-station surveys before and after the Massachusetts Bay Transportation Authority deployed real-time information to measure changes in satisfaction and wait time expectations. Their results revealed that after the introduction of countdown signs, people reduced their overestimation of wait time by 50% ( 10 ). Similarly, research commissioned by OneBusAway in Seattle found that real-time information decreases the perceived average wait time by 0.7 min or about 13% ( 6 ).…”
